Chief Executive Assistant

Join Hire Hangar and work with fast-growing global companies while building a long-term career.

Location: Remote

Time Zone: US Eastern (ET) preferred; must overlap core ET working hours

Role Overview: You are the CEO's command center and execution integrator across a 3-business portfolio (luxury Caribbean vacation rental asset management, home services/insulation, and Boston real estate development). You translate fast-moving ideas into clear plans, systems, and follow-through—keeping operators accountable so nothing slips.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Own the CEO's calendar, priorities, weekly planning rhythm, and daily execution check-ins
  • Convert "brain dumps" into structured tasks, owners, deadlines, and follow-ups (with escalation when needed)
  • Drive cross-business execution: unify plans, remove blockers, and keep momentum through rapid pivots
  • Maintain a weekly portfolio scorecard (marketing, sales KPIs, project milestones, risks, next actions)
  • Partner with key operators/partners (Ops, Sales, and Deal partners) to track commitments and accountability
  • Coordinate across time zones and teams (including St. Martin ground support and remote VAs)
  • Support light investor/client communication (owners/investors, not guests)

Required Qualifications:

  • Experience working as Chief of Staff / Senior Executive Assistant / Operations Partner roles supporting a founder or CEO
  • Proven ability to run execution systems end-to-end (priorities → plans → tracking → completion)
  • Comfort enforcing accountability with senior operators and partners; clear, confident follow-up style
  • Strong project management skills (ClickUp, Asana, or equivalent) and KPI reporting discipline
  • Non-negotiable: Prior remote work experience; fluent with remote collaboration tools (Slack, Zoom, Google Workspace, Asana/ClickUp or similar) and ideally experience working with US or UK-based companies—applications without this will not be considered.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ience supporting multi-business or portfolio operators
  • Working knowledge of CRM + marketing ops workflows (email sequences, tagging, lead routing)
  • Exposure to real estate development or home services operations

Tools & Technology: ClickUp/Asana, Google Workspace, Slack/Zoom, Airtable/Google Sheets, CRM (HubSpot/GoHighLevel/Salesforce or similar), Zapier/Make, AI tools for writing/automation (e.g., ChatGPT)
